3. Body Mass Index

Body Mass Index (BMI), calculated as weight in kilograms divided by height in meters squared, provides a standardized metric for assessing body weight relative to height. In the context of the “heaviest player in nba currently,” BMI offers a perspective beyond absolute weight, indicating whether that weight is proportional to the player’s height or indicative of overweight or obesity. While BMI is not a direct measure of body composition (i.e., muscle versus fat), it serves as a readily available screening tool for potential health risks associated with excessive weight. For example, a player listed as the heaviest in the NBA might have a BMI classified as obese, suggesting a higher risk of cardiovascular disease, joint problems, and other weight-related health issues. This necessitates careful medical monitoring and tailored training programs.

The interpretation of BMI for the “heaviest player in nba currently” requires careful consideration of their unique athletic profile. NBA players, particularly those with significant muscle mass, may have elevated BMIs that do not accurately reflect their health status. A player with a high BMI primarily due to muscle, rather than excess fat, may not face the same health risks as someone with a similar BMI resulting from higher fat percentage. Therefore, BMI should be used in conjunction with other assessments, such as body fat percentage measurements, body composition analysis, and cardiovascular fitness tests, to provide a comprehensive understanding of the player’s overall health. Shaquille O’Neal, throughout his NBA career, often had a high BMI; however, his strength and dominance were undeniably linked to his muscular physique.

6. Injury History

The injury history of the “heaviest player in nba currently” presents a critical consideration regarding career longevity and sustained performance. Substantial body mass places significant stress on joints, ligaments, and the musculoskeletal system, potentially predisposing these athletes to a higher incidence and severity of certain injuries. Understanding this correlation is essential for proactive injury prevention and management strategies.

  • Increased Joint Stress

    Elevated weight directly increases the load on weight-bearing joints such as knees, ankles, and hips. This heightened stress can accelerate the degeneration of cartilage, increasing the risk of osteoarthritis and related conditions. For the “heaviest player in nba currently,” this translates to a greater likelihood of experiencing knee pain, ankle sprains, and hip impingement. Shaquille O’Neal, despite his dominance, experienced knee problems throughout his career, partially attributable to his immense size and the repetitive impact of playing in the paint.

  • Heightened Risk of Soft Tissue Injuries

    The musculoskeletal system, encompassing muscles, tendons, and ligaments, is also susceptible to injury due to the strain imposed by increased weight. Tendinopathies, muscle strains, and ligament sprains are common occurrences. For the “heaviest player in nba currently,” rapid movements and changes in direction can place undue stress on these tissues, increasing the likelihood of injuries such as Achilles tendinitis, hamstring strains, and ankle sprains. These injuries can significantly impact mobility and playing time.

  • Cardiovascular Strain and Recovery

    Increased body mass places greater demands on the cardiovascular system. The heart must work harder to circulate blood throughout the body, potentially leading to increased blood pressure and other cardiovascular complications. This strain can also impact recovery time from strenuous activity. The “heaviest player in nba currently” may require more extensive recovery periods between games and training sessions to mitigate the risk of fatigue-related injuries and maintain optimal performance. Monitoring cardiovascular health is paramount.
